For a biologically-based mad scientist, you could take lots of item-creation feats (or go all-out on that route and play an Artificer) and ask your DM to let you reflavor the items into biologically engineered abominations.

It works even with simple, low-level items. Potions could be small, jellyfish-like creatures that brew the magically charged liquids inside their own body; you take the potion by swallowing the jellyfish. Scrolls? You've learned to imprint a mouse brain (either undead or live and floating in a vial of nutrients) with a single spell; activating it takes a command word and a primitive mental link (requiring exactly the same effort as activating a normal scroll) and burns out the brain as it channels more energy than it was ever meant to handle.

And so on; wands, womdrous items, and even some types of weapons and armor could be made biological in nature. (And you can place them anywhere you want on the scale of elegant genetically engineered creations through horrible travesties of life that should never exist outside of nightmares.)
